Abstract

Data sharing plays a vital role in forming a complete blockchain system. This paper focuses on how to incent the enterprises in the blockchain of enterprise alliance to upload offline data to the chain to complete data sharing in the blockchain. To encourage enterprises to actively upload shared data to the blockchain, it is necessary to give reasonable rewards to the enterprises sharing data and punishments to the enterprises not sharing data. This paper builds an incentive model for data sharing of enterprises, and analyzes the evolutionary stable strategies in different conditions using evolutionary game theory. When the evolutionary game reaches a stable state and all enterprises choose to share data, the incentive value in the stable state is a reasonable incentive value. And then, with the automatic execution of smart contract in the blockchain, the incentive mechanism of data sharing can be written into the smart contract. When enterprises upload data, the incentive is automatically triggered to continuously encourage enterprises to upload data. Finally, several evolutionary stable strategies are simulated and verified by using Repast.
